What is this “love” of God that we rely on? That God sent His one and only Son to save us from the penalty of our sin. Our inherent human condition is separated from God, but God loved us while we were sinners and provided a way for restoration of fellowship with Him that sin destroyed. That provision is Jesus Christ.
How do we do this? We understand that we need a Savior because we are sinful and we believe that Jesus is the way, the truth and the life. We repent of our sin and surrender our entire lives to Jesus as Lord and Savior. We decide to no longer live for ourself and selfish desires but for Him. And then a miraculous divine exchange happens! His shed blood washes us clean, gives us brand new life and God places His powerful Holy Spirit inside of us to help us, guide us and lead us in abundant life. We are now “in Christ!”
And so we now live our lives from a place of receiving Gods love. knowing Gods love, and relying solely on it in every way. It’s a posture of rest not striving. It’s a position of daughter-ship (or sonship) instead of an orphan. And it’s a daily adventure of letting go of walking by sight because we trust Gods ways are higher, better and working altogether for His glory and our good!!
Be encouraged today that you can rest and rely on the faithfulness of God in every season of your life. You can rest in His love—you don’t have to earn it. It’s a free gift just to receive. And it’s for everyone—and it’s the best gift that just keeps getting better the closer you walk with Jesus!!
